Transaction 7657fccd73ae91e63c488d2f23f3c418efdd37a340bac27f0eaef3356ba8d876

2 Input
2 Outputs
  • 7657fccd73ae91e63c488d2f23f3c418efdd37a340bac27f0eaef3356ba8d876:0
  • value  4971407
    address  31yD8DsYUpkwchYAkjKTyQDhRVTihsjGgo
  • 7657fccd73ae91e63c488d2f23f3c418efdd37a340bac27f0eaef3356ba8d876:1
  • value  150000000
    address  35M9nGrqZ7SV412BtGMUNp1WexTbHRWdFg